Annual Cash Flow-to-Debt Ratio for Aarvee Denims & Exports Limited (2006–2025)

| Year | CF-to-Debt Ratio | Operating CF (INR) | Total Liabilities | YoY Change |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| 0.16x | Rs274.72 Million | Rs1.69 Billion | ▼ -37.6% |
| 2024 | 0.26x | Rs1.10 Billion | Rs4.21 Billion | ▲ +207.0% |
| 2023 | 0.08x | Rs396.46 Million | Rs4.66 Billion | ▲ +241.0% |
| 2022 | 0.02x | Rs125.21 Million | Rs5.02 Billion | ▼ -70.2% |
| 2021 | 0.08x | Rs454.12 Million | Rs5.43 Billion | ▼ -20.8% |
| 2020 | 0.11x | Rs645.88 Million | Rs6.12 Billion | ▲ +41.0% |
| 2019 | 0.07x | Rs505.67 Million | Rs6.76 Billion | ▲ +28.2% |
| 2018 | 0.06x | Rs377.69 Million | Rs6.47 Billion | ▼ -66.1% |
| 2017 | 0.17x | Rs966.01 Million | Rs5.61 Billion | ▲ +28.9% |
| 2016 | 0.13x | Rs749.32 Million | Rs5.61 Billion | ▲ +47.1% |
| 2015 | 0.09x | Rs467.93 Million | Rs5.15 Billion | ▼ -28.7% |
| 2014 | 0.13x | Rs683.75 Million | Rs5.36 Billion | ▲ +18.2% |
| 2013 | 0.11x | Rs531.70 Million | Rs4.93 Billion | ▲ +7.2% |
| 2012 | 0.10x | Rs493.37 Million | Rs4.90 Billion | ▼ -42.6% |
| 2011 | 0.18x | Rs658.68 Million | Rs3.76 Billion | ▲ +45.4% |
| 2010 | 0.12x | Rs377.40 Million | Rs3.13 Billion | ▲ +498.2% |
| 2009 | 0.02x | Rs62.82 Million | Rs3.12 Billion | ▲ +110.5% |
| 2008 | -0.19x | Rs-473.40 Million | Rs2.47 Billion | ▼ -133.1% |
| 2007 | 0.58x | Rs1.18 Billion | Rs2.04 Billion | ▲ +244.7% |
| 2006 | 0.17x | Rs176.70 Million | Rs1.05 Billion | — |
